What Modus Coffee say
Meet Elias Roa, a dedicated producer from Huila, Colombia. Alongside his wife Bellanid, daughter Derlin, and son in law Diego Campos (a Colombian Barista Champion), Elias grows exceptional coffee at Finca Tamana in Pital. Working with heirloom varieties linked to African origins, he uses careful techniques including dry fermentation, fresh water washing and slow drying on raised beds to ensure each bean expresses its full origin.
This lot is decaffeinated using ethyl acetate, a naturally occurring compound found in fruits like bananas. Through a gentle and thorough method, the caffeine is removed while the vibrant character of the coffee is preserved. The result is a clean and flavourful decaf that reflects the same care and quality as the Roa family’s regular harvests. A cup full of sweetness, structure and clarity — minus the buzz.
